It was just meh. Gal Gadot was good and the basic premise of the movie was OK. The action scenes were well done, and Chris Pine and Gadot had solid chemistry. That said, the whole movie seemed very by-the-numbers. From her rebellion against her mom to the recycled fish-out-of-water comedy when Diana gets to London, to the Expendables version WW, there wasn't anything new in this movie other than the superhero being a heroine. Hooray!!!!

I could have gotten past all that, but the villain of this movie was Ludendorff? Of all the characters to pluck out of history to be the villain, they couldn't have come up with someone more interesting? It's like the writers knew Ludendorff was a dud so they had him doing blow to make him more interesting. Danny Huston would have been overacting if he was in a Dolph Lundgren movie.
